directions
- Dissolve sugar in bourbon in a large glass pitcher.
- Cut lemons in half& squeeze the juice into the pitcher- watch the pips.
- Toss rinds into the concoction& refrigerate overnight.
- Remove the lemon rinds just before serving.
- For each drink, add 1 1/2 to 2 oz of the bourbon mixture to a shaker.
- Shake& strain into a highball glass filled with ice.
- Garnish with a lemon twist.
